Three or four day cruise?

Three college friends are considering a three or four day cruise from Miami in early March. Can you recommend any? We'd like something offering decent food, gambling, and some other activities.

Thanks for any thoughts, including alternative destinations/points of departure.

I have done both Carnivals and RCL on 3-4 days to the Bahamas. Carnivals ship is a much better choice. The food was better and the crowd fun and active. Gambling on both ships were about the same. I'd recommend the Yellowbird party boat which ever you choose Carnival's prices were cheaper on both that I took to the Bahamas over RCL's prices. All 3 lefts out of Miami, but I have flown into both Miami and Ft Lauderdale. You can get transportation at the airports which was considerably cheaper than going thru the cruise line. Have fun. First take the 4 day. The first day you are trying to find your way around the ship and there is a long boring life boat drill so if you take the 4 day you will have more time to enjoy the cruise.
College age people should stick with carnival.

A cruise is generaly cheaper out of Tampa or Fort Lauderdale than Miami. Almost all the cruise lines have great food or people would not keep coming back to them. Royal Carribean has a rock wall and wave pool which are great fun. They also have clubs for dancing at night so I would not worry too much about not having enough to do onboard.
